    I can't believe I forgot all about this item. I purchased it for just a quarter at a benefit yard sale. I took one look at it and it was love at first sight. I couldn't get all the images but the bottom of the can doesn't have any rust on it and has all the brass finish. It also has all the letters clearly printed. and the rest of the can isn't rusty either. Their is of course paint wear and tarnishing consistent with age.
